Crafting Effective Reminder Call Scripts
The language used in your reminder calls significantly impacts their effectiveness. Concise, friendly scripts that get straight to the point typically perform best. Start with a clear identification of who’s calling and why, followed by the essential appointment details.
For example:
"Hello [Client Name], this is [Business Name] calling with a friendly reminder about your [appointment type] scheduled for [date] at [time]. Please press 1 to confirm, 2 to reschedule, or stay on the line to speak with our scheduling team."

Compliance and Best Practices for Reminder Calls
Navigating the regulatory landscape for automated calls requires attention to detail. In the United States, reminder calls must comply with the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A), which governs automated calling systems. Similar regulations exist internationally, such as GDPR in Europe and CASL in Canada.
Best practices include:
- Obtaining explicit consent for automated reminders during the initial appointment booking
- Providing clear opt-out mechanisms in every communication
- Limiting call times to reasonable hours (typically 8 AM to 9 PM in the recipient’s time zone)
- Maintaining detailed records of consent and communication preferences
- Using HIPAA-compliant systems for healthcare reminders

Psychological Factors That Make Reminder Calls Effective
The science behind reminder call effectiveness involves several psychological principles. The commitment and consistency principle suggests that once people verbally confirm an appointment, they’re more likely to follow through. This explains why interactive reminder calls that request confirmation outperform passive notifications.
Timing also matters psychologically. Reminders that arrive too early are often forgotten, while those arriving too late don’t allow for adequate preparation. The sweet spot—24 to 48 hours before the appointment—provides enough time to prepare without being too distant from the actual event.
The personalization effect demonstrates why AI voice conversations that include the client’s name and specific appointment details generate higher attendance rates than generic reminders. When clients feel personally acknowledged, their sense of obligation increases.

Reminder Calls for Special Populations
Certain groups benefit from tailored reminder call approaches. Elderly patients often prefer traditional phone calls over text messages and appreciate slower, clearer speech patterns in automated systems. Healthcare conversational AI can be programmed to adopt these characteristics when demographic data suggests an older recipient.
For non-English speakers, sophisticated reminder systems now offer multilingual capabilities that automatically match the language preference in the patient record. This significantly improves appointment adherence in diverse communities. Spanish AI conversation systems have shown particular value in practices with large Hispanic populations.
Patients with chronic conditions who require frequent appointments benefit from reminder systems that maintain continuity across their care journey, recognizing patterns and providing context-aware reminders that reference previous or upcoming appointments in their treatment sequence.
